Versions in this module Expand all Collapse all v1 v1.0.0 Aug 24, 2022 Changes in this version + const AlphaNum + const Byte + const Numeric + type Bitmap struct + func NewBitmap(width, height int) *Bitmap + func (b *Bitmap) At(x, y int) bool + func (b *Bitmap) Copy() *Bitmap + func (b *Bitmap) Fill(x, y, w, h int, value bool) + func (b *Bitmap) Height() int + func (b *Bitmap) Invert() + func (b *Bitmap) Place(x, y int, other *Bitmap) + func (b *Bitmap) Set(x, y int, value bool) + func (b *Bitmap) Width() int + type Buffer struct + func NewBuffer() *Buffer + func (b *Buffer) Add(val, size int) + func (b *Buffer) Bytes() []byte + func (b *Buffer) Clear() + func (b *Buffer) Size() int + func (b *Buffer) String() string + func (b *Buffer) Write(data string) + type Options struct + Error string + Mode int + Version int + type QRCode struct + func NewQRCode(data string, options *Options) (*QRCode, error) + func (qr *QRCode) Bitmap() *Bitmap + func (qr *QRCode) ErrorLevel() string + func (qr *QRCode) Mode() int + func (qr *QRCode) Render(filename string, scale int) error + func (qr *QRCode) Version() int